On today’s pod, I am joined by Tom and David as we take a look back on the historic and memorable 2022/23 rugby season in Ireland. There was a clean sweep in the Autumn, a senior and u20 grand slam, a dreaded wooden spoon, a 7s World Cup semi-final, Olympic qualification, a first URC champion and a rare Dublin Champions Cup final. Bonus Pod: URC Grand Final Preview

Coming up on today's bonus podcast, we look ahead to the upcoming URC Grand Final. Reigning champions Stormers are back on home soil for another league final. Facing them, the mighty Munster. Led by first year head coach Graham Rowntree, Munster return to their first final since 2021, but have not claimed silverware since a decade prior to that.
